Just What Are Robot Cleaners?
Robot cleaners are autonomous gadgets created to tidy floors without direct human control. They navigate your home using a mix of sensing units, mapping technology, and algorithms to successfully clean various floor surface areas. While the term "robot cleaner" can incorporate a series of devices, in the context of home cleaning, it primarily refers to 2 primary categories:
Robot Vacuum Cleaners: These are the most common type, designed to autonomously vacuum floors, getting dust, dirt, pet hair, and particles. They normally feature brushes, suction power, and filters to effectively collect and contain the dust.Robot Mop Cleaners: These robots are designed to mop difficult floorings, removing spills, spots, and grime. They typically dispense water or cleaning solution and utilize a mopping pad to clean the surface. Some advanced models can even vacuum and mop simultaneously or sequentially.
While less common for home use, other types of robot cleaners exist, such as those designed for pool or windows. Nevertheless, for the purpose of this short article, we will mostly concentrate on robot vacuum and mop cleaners ideal for UK homes.

Choosing the Right Robot Cleaner for Your UK Home
With a huge array of robot cleaners available in the UK market, selecting the best one can feel frustrating. Here are vital factors to think about to guarantee you choose a robot cleaner that fulfills your particular needs and home environment:
Floor Types: Consider the kinds of flooring in your house. Most robot vacuum cleaners are developed to deal with a mix of hard floors and carpets. However, if you have predominantly thick carpets, look for models with strong suction power and robust brush rolls developed for carpets. For homes with primarily tough floorings, robot mops or combination vacuum-mop robotics might be perfect.Home Size and Layout: Larger homes or multi-story homes may require robotics with longer battery life and advanced mapping capabilities. Think about the robot's coverage area and whether it can handle several rooms and navigate complex layouts. For smaller sized flats or houses, a basic design with a much shorter battery life might suffice.Pet Ownership: If you have family pets, specifically those that shed heavily, focus on robot cleaners with strong suction, tangle-free brush rolls developed for pet hair, and reliable purification systems to trap allergens. Larger dustbins are also beneficial for homes with animals.Smart Features and Connectivity: Decide which smart features are necessary to you. Do you want app control, scheduling, zone cleaning, virtual limits, or voice assistant combination? These features can substantially improve the user experience and customizability of your cleaning.Budget plan: Robot cleaners range in rate from entry-level models under ₤ 200 to high-end devices surpassing ₤ 800 and even ₤ 1000. Identify your budget plan and research study designs within that price range, stabilizing features and performance with expense.Battery Life and Charging: Consider the robot's battery life and charging time. Ensure the battery life is adequate to clean your desired location on a single charge. Some robotics include automatic charging, returning to their charging dock when the battery is low and resuming cleaning when charged.Dustbin Capacity: A larger dustbin capability means less frequent emptying. This is especially important for larger homes or homes with family pets.Navigation and Mapping: Different robots utilize numerous navigation systems. Standard models might use random bounce navigation, while advanced designs use systematic navigation with mapping technology. Mapping enables more efficient cleaning paths, virtual limits, and zoned cleaning.Noise Level: If noise is a concern, check the decibel score of the robot cleaner. Some models are designed to run more quietly than others.Brand Name Reputation and Reviews: Research reliable brands and check out customer reviews to evaluate the dependability, efficiency, and client support of various models.

Using and Maintaining Your Robot Cleaner
To ensure your robot cleaner functions efficiently and lasts for years, appropriate usage and upkeep are essential. Here are some key pointers:
Prepare Your Home: Before running your robot cleaner, clean up cable televisions, little objects, and loose rugs that could obstruct its course.Frequently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ning session or as needed, particularly if you have animals or a bigger home.Tidy Brushes and Filters: Regularly clean the brushes and filters according to the producer's directions. This ensures optimal cleaning efficiency and avoids dust accumulation.Examine and Clean Sensors: Gently clean the robot's sensing units to guarantee precise navigation and barrier detection.Replace Parts as Needed: Brush rolls, filters, and mopping pads will eventually require changing. Follow the manufacturer's suggestions for replacement intervals.Keep the Charging Dock Clear: Ensure the charging dock is quickly accessible and complimentary from obstructions.Follow Manufacturer's Guidelines: Always describe the user handbook provided with your robot cleaner for particular instructions on usage,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s) about Robot Cleaners in the UK
Are robot cleaners suitable for all UK homes?
Robot cleaners are suitable for most UK homes. Consider your floor types, home size, and particular cleaning requires when selecting a design. They work well in flats, houses, and apartments.
Just how much do robot cleaners expense in the UK?
Rates vary commonly. Entry-level designs begin with under ₤ 200, mid-range models v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, and high-end models can cost ₤ 500 to over ₤ 1000.
Where can I buy robot cleaners in the UK?
Robot cleaners are widely offered at significant retailers in the UK, consisting of Currys PC World, Argos, John Lewis, Amazon UK, and directly from brand sites.
Do robot cleaners deal with carpets?
Yes, numerous robot vacuum are created to work on carpets. Search for models with strong suction power and brush rolls appropriate for carpets.
Do robot cleaners work on pet hair?
Yes, lots of robot cleaners are excellent for pet hair. Look for models particularly created for pet hair with tangle-free brush rolls and HEPA filters.
What is the battery life of a robot cleaner?
Battery life varies depending upon the model, usually varying from 60 to 120 minutes or more.
Do robot cleaners include a service warranty in the UK?
Yes, a lot of robot cleaners purchased in the UK included a manufacturer's service warranty, usually for 1-2 years. Examine the service warranty details when acquiring.
Are robot cleaners loud?
Robot cleaners are usually quieter than conventional vacuum, however noise levels vary. Check the decibel score if noise is a concern.
